Quality Operations Engineer
vor 12 Stunden
Job Summary
The Quality Operations Engineer plays a critical role in ensuring that products manufactured by external suppliers and CMOs meet applicable regulatory, quality, and business requirements. This individual serves as a key liaison between the company and its external manufacturing partners, driving quality oversight across manufacturing, incoming inspection, and product release. The position involves hands-on review of batch records, investigation of nonconformances, support for equipment qualification (IQ/OQ/PQ), and verification of incoming materials—all in accordance with ISO 13485, FDA QSR, and other applicable standards.
Responsibilities
- Collaborate with CMOs and suppliers to ensure quality deliverables are met throughout the product lifecycle, from material receipt to final release.
- Perform review and approval of manufacturing batch records, ensuring compliance with product specifications, Good Manufacturing Practices (GMP), and internal procedures.
- Participate in incoming inspection activities: review Certificates of Analysis (CoA), dimensional and visual inspection reports, and material certifications; assist in material disposition and drive resolution of discrepancies.
- Participate in nonconformance (NC) review and disposition, including root causes analysis and implementation of corrective and preventive actions (CAPA).
- Support or lead batch release activities, including review of DHRs (Device History Records) and verification of QC test results.
- Interface with Regulatory Affairs, Procurement, and Manufacturing teams to ensure timely product release and issue resolution.
- Participate in supplier audits, readiness assessments, and quality improvement initiatives.
- Ensure compliance with applicable ISO 13485, FDA 21 CFR Part 820, MDR, and internal QMS policies.
- Maintain accurate quality documentation and records in accordance with document control and record retention requirements.
- Oversee equipment qualification and process validation activities (IQ/OQ/PQ) performed at supplier and CMO sites, ensuring documented evidence of compliance.
Experience, Qualifications & Skills
- Bachelor or Master's degree in Engineering, Life Sciences, or a related technical discipline.
- Fluent in English
- Minimum of 3–5 years of experience in Quality Assurance, ideally in a medical device or pharmaceutical manufacturing environment.
- Knowledge of ISO 13485, FDA QSR, and GxP regulations.
- Experience working with CMOs and suppliers, especially in a regulated environment.
- Familiarity with batch record review, NC/CAPA processes, IQ/OQ/PQ, and risk-based quality approaches.
- Strong analytical and problem-solving skills.
- Excellent communication and collaboration abilities.
- Experience with quality management systems (e.g., MasterControl, TrackWise, Veeva, or similar) is a plus.
